National security in Saudi Arabia : threats, responses, and challenges

Author: Anthony H Cordesman; Nawaf E Obaid; Center for Strategic and International Studies (Washington, D.C.)
Publisher: Westport, Conn. : Praeger Security International, 2005.

Contents: The new balance of threats in the Gulf region -- Asymmetric threats and Islamist extremists -- External strategic pressures -- The Saudi security apparatus -- Saudi military forces -- The Saudi paramilitary and internal security apparatus -- Saudi energy security -- Military reform -- Internal security reform -- The broader priorities for security reform.
